Happy Birthday to the East Bay Regional Park District, celebrating 85 years!    Thank you for protecting open space in Alameda and Contra Costa Counties and giving us access to trails for hiking, shorelines, biking, swimming,  horseback riding, boating, fishing, camping and nature!  The East Bay Regional Park District is the largest of its kind in the nation with 73 regional parks, over 122,000 acres and over 25 million annual visits per year.  

Celebrate their 85th birthday with FREE ADMISSION FRIDAYS!

Park entry and other fees will be waived every Friday in 2019 from April to December to celebrate the Park District’s 85th Anniversary. Park entrance and fees for day use parking, swimming, dogs, horse trailers, boat launching, and local fishing permit fees* will all be waived.
